Handover Note — Lease Renegotiation, Aldmere House

From Director Hale Cromarty to Director Sada Venn. Negotiations with the landlord, Thornefield Estates, have reached a second draft: a five-year term with a break clause at year three and a 12% reduction in service charges. Legal review concludes Thursday. Full background on our position is given in the confidential note below.

confidential, fahip-bagep: The southern region missed its Holwyn quota by 21.5 percent last quarter. Sorvanek Foods plans to raise the Jorir list price by 23.9 percent in December. The pricing group signed off on a budget of $411.6 million for Project Eliion. The renewal with Juldorix Works closes at $87.9 million a year, 16.8 percent below the last contract.

/*
 * VALIDATOR_PLUGIN_ABI_VERSION
 *
 * Gatewell's validator plugins are loaded at startup from the
 * plugins/ directory and must declare a matching ABI version.
 * Bump this constant whenever the ValidatorContext struct changes,
 * otherwise older plugins will pass stale field offsets and fail
 * silently on nested schemas. The loader refuses mismatches at
 * registration time, not at call time. Last verified against the
 * following build:
 */

session token of tajef-bageg = htk21_5d90d574934f3ccae6437

Subject: Temporary reception site during Kestrel Wing renovation

While the Kestrel Wing at Bramblehurst Court is under renovation, reception operations move to the ground floor of the Annexe, beside the courtyard entrance. Please direct all visitors there from Monday onward. Deliveries should also be rerouted; signage will be posted at both entrances. The Annexe side door remains locked at all times, so reception staff will need the temporary door-pass code to enter each morning. The code for the duration of the works is as follows:

door code, yagap-bahof: bdg-O-05

Leadership Review Briefing — Branch Managers

Topic: customer-concentration risk. Torvane Logistics now accounts for 41% of revenue in the eastern region, up from 29% last year. A contract renegotiation or loss would materially affect branch targets. Mitigation workstreams include mid-market outreach and a revised incentive plan for new-logo wins. Please review your pipelines before the session. The mitigation strategy is detailed below.

board note of yadup-fajef: Druiusox Holdings is in early talks to buy Norwynek Systems for about $186.0 million. The Kaseth launch date is June 24, and nothing goes to the press before then. Legal wants the Quenethek Group term sheet withdrawn before November 27.